Integration Engineer (Starship)
On-site · Brownsville, Texas, United States
Job Summary
Integration Engineer role focused on integrating avionics, propulsion, and structural subsystems for Starship. Responsible for establishing requirements, designing and implementing tooling to enable at-rate production, automating processes for repeatability on a large-scale production line, and proving subsystem centers meet cycle-time targets. Work with design engineering and technician teams to influence vehicle architecture with emphasis on reliability and manufacturability; develop, maintain, and improve design-for-manufacturing requirements for build processes; require hands-on engineering experience and familiarity with GD&T, CAD/PLM tools, and aerospace manufacturing practices. Travel up to 10% and ability to work in physically demanding environments (heights, confined spaces, outdoor conditions) are noted; ITAR restrictions apply.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in engineering
- 1+ years of hands-on engineering experience (design teams and previous internships qualify)
Additional Requirements
- ITAR compliance: US citizen or national, permanent resident, refugee, or asylee or eligible to obtain required authorizations
